Output 24c633eba61ae5385352e716fbdb24081593a81ba1181c0287a55e1f736bdbb3:1

value
323227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59034bcccf4dc33e162f8c42fac40f751b441b6 OP_EQUAL
address
3MAEc1gZUw143D8moWMSZFB73yM9csu8ks
transaction
24c633eba61ae5385352e716fbdb24081593a81ba1181c0287a55e1f736bdbb3
confirmations
494163
spent
true